On the early 1900’s, the area was full of silver mineworkers, who established the area its notable name. Nowadays, the area is covered with skiers ,but the bunches are preferably light.

The area turned a skier’s paradise in 1957. It was originated by Robert Barrett, who gained his luck as a uranium miner. He essentially began evolving the resort, since he was refused restroom prerogatives at the ski area in Alta  as he wasn’t a guest.Today possessed by a different family, the resort boasts 1200 acres of 63 runs for novices, medium skiers, and experts. There are eight lifts, including seven chairlifts and one surface lift. The top elevation at Solitude Mountain is 10036 feet, with a vertical drop of 2048 feet.
